Which was the main concern with the first draft of the articles of confederation

History
1 answer:
spin [16.1K]3 years ago
4 0
The main concern was that it wast strong enough to enforce itself. Basically, it would have been passed, but if the people chose to ignore/disobey it, they could have gotten away with doing so.
